
Ernesto Nazareth
(1863-1934)
Espalhafatoso, Brejeiro, Confidências, Escovado, Nenê, Ameno Resedá, Turbilhão De Beijos, Gaúcho, Plangente, Topázio Líquido, Ouro Sobre Azul, Sarambeque, Epônina, Escorregando, Tenebroso, Odeon & Apanhei-Te Cavaquinho
Iara Behs, piano
Naxos 8.557687 63:24
The Brazilian Nazareth was originally influenced by Chopin, wrote in the styles of the dances of his era, and in turn influenced a later generation of composers. The seventeen tracks have a variety of moods and more than once you'll find yourself half-expecting a tune you think you know but it turns out you don't. Those who respond to the music of Gottschalk will find much to enjoy.
